Payitaht: Abdülhamid is a massive Turkish historical television drama that details the final 13 years of the reign of Sultan Abdul Hamid II, the 34th Sultan of the Ottoman Empire. Spanning five seasons, it dives heavily into political intrigue, war, and the socio-political struggles of the late 19th and early 20th centuries.

For viewers in the Balkan regions (Serbia, Croatia, Bosnia), community "repacks" with local subtitles ("sa prevodom") are the primary way to consume this colossal saga outside of official streaming markets. 🌟 The Good: What Makes It Stand Out

Stellar Acting: Bülent İnal delivers a powerhouse, commanding performance as Sultan Abdul Hamid II. His portrayal is widely praised as the anchor holding the massive production together.

Production Value: The set designs, period-accurate costuming, and cinematography are exceptionally high quality, matching the standard of big-budget historical dramas.

Intense Political Drama: If you enjoy shows centered around espionage, tactical masterminds, and court conspiracies, this series delivers constant tension. ⚠️ The Bad: Polarizing Weaknesses

Extreme Revisionism: The show operates heavily as a historical revisionist project. It paints a highly idealized "black-and-white" picture of good vs. evil. Nuance is often abandoned in favor of making the Sultan an infallible figure.

Pacing and Length: Like most Turkish dizis, episodes are incredibly long (often over 2 hours each). Plotlines can drag significantly across its 100+ episode run. 💻 The "Repack sa Prevodom" Experience

Historical Focus: The show focuses on the Sultan’s struggle to preserve the Ottoman Empire against internal and external enemies, including the Young Turks, Zionists, and various European powers.

Production Quality: Produced by TRT, the series is known for its high-budget costumes, grand palace sets, and intense political dialogue.

Timeline: It spans five seasons, concluding with the Sultan's eventual deposition. Critical & Audience Review Strengths:

Bülent İnal’s Performance: His portrayal of Abdul Hamid II is widely praised for capturing the Sultan's intelligence, piety, and strategic mind.

Educational Value: For those interested in late-Ottoman history, the show provides a dramatic look at events like the 1897 Greco-Turkish War and the construction of the Hejaz Railway. Weaknesses:

Historical Accuracy: Critics and historians often note that the series is a "historical revisionist" project. It is designed more as a nationalist drama than a strictly factual documentary.

Discovering "Payitaht: Abdülhamid": A Deep Dive into the Last Great Ottoman Struggle

For fans of historical drama, few series capture the intricate web of late 19th-century geopolitics as vividly as Payitaht: Abdülhamid. Often searched by regional fans as "Payitaht Abdulhamid sa prevodom repack," this epic Turkish production follows the final 13 years of Sultan Abdülhamid II's reign, the 34th Sultan of the Ottoman Empire.

The series is more than just a royal biopic; it is a fictionalized, revisionist look at a ruler fighting to preserve his empire against internal dissent and global powers. The Story: A Struggle for Existence

The narrative begins during the 20th year of the Sultan's reign in 1896. The Ottoman Empire is at a critical crossroads, facing pressure from the Berlin Conference and shifting global alliances. Key historical milestones featured in the show include:

The Hejaz Railway: A massive infrastructure project aimed at connecting the holy lands, which faces constant sabotage from foreign interests and internal traitors.

The Greco-Turkish War (1897): A significant military conflict that resulted in a rare Ottoman victory during the empire's decline.

Political Conspiracies: The Sultan must navigate the ambitions of the Young Turks, the influence of the Freemasons, and the demands of the First Zionist Congress regarding Palestinian lands. Exploring the Cast and Characters

The series' success is driven by powerful performances from a massive cast of nearly 50 main members and hundreds of extras.

Bülent İnal stars as Sultan Abdülhamid II, portraying him as a determined, just, yet embattled leader.

Özlem Conker plays Bidar Kadın Efendi, the Sultan's wife, who navigates the complex rivalries within the palace harem.

Hakan Boyav appears as Mahmud Paşa, the Sultan's brother-in-law, who often works behind the scenes to sabotage imperial projects.

Saygın Soysal portrays Theodor Herzl, the journalist and political activist who clashes with the Sultan over Palestinian territory. Understanding the "Repack" and "Sa Prevodom" Search
